Tandem Diabetes Care Receives FDA Clearance for Control-IQ+ Technology for Type 2 Diabetes
What You Should Know:
- Tandem Diabetes Care, a insulin delivery and diabetes technology company, announced that its Control-IQ+ technology has received clearance from the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) for use by adults with type 2 diabetes.
- The expanded indication builds on the success of Control-IQ+ in type 1 diabetes and offers a new automated insulin delivery (AID) option for individuals with type 2 diabetes.

Strados Labs and BIDMC Launch Study to Evaluate AI-Powered Biosensor for Early Detection of Pulmonary Edema
What You Should Know:
- Strados Labs, a medical technology company focused on respiratory health, today announced a new collaboration with Beth Israel Deaconess Medical Center (BIDMC) to evaluate the use of its RESP® Biosensor for the early detection of pulmonary edema in critically ill patients.
- The pilot study, scheduled to begin at the end of February 2025, will enroll 20 patients and is expected to last 12 months.
